Spy Hunter is a classic arcade game released by Bally Midway in 1983. The game puts players in the role of a secret agent driving an armed sports car, tasked with eliminating enemy vehicles while avoiding civilian traffic. Featuring top-down gameplay, it became renowned for its innovative use of vehicle transformations, allowing the player's car to turn into a boat. Its memorable soundtrack, inspired by the James Bond theme, and unique gameplay mechanics made "Spy Hunter" a beloved title in the arcade gaming scene of the 1980s.
